Lao Cai seeks solutions for mining, hydroelectric enterprises

(VEN) - The Lao Cai Provincial People’s Committee recently organized a conference on solving difficulties for industrial enterprises during operation in the province. The event was attended by more than 40 mining and mineral processing, and hydroelectric businesses.

There are now 18 eligible enterprises operating at 24 mining sites in Lao Cai and they have been implementing projects in accordance with the approved planning. During operations, most of the businesses have been encountering difficulties in site clearance, legal procedures for land-related issues, and waste disposal. Others have problems in financial imbalance, resulting in difficulties in correcting technologies.

In the field of hydropower, there are 73 existing hydropower projects in Lao Cai with a total capacity of over 1,148 MW. Seven other projects are under construction with a total installed capacity of 87.1MW; and 12 others have been approved with a total installed capacity of 107MW...

As for a number of hydropower projects from 2012 and earlier, the appraisal and approval of technical designs falls under the authority of investors, leading to inconsistent technical specifications in related documents. Some projects are still having problems with land lease, site clearance and compensation while others are lagging behind schedule.

At the conference, businesses informed participants about the difficulties and obstacles they are encountering during their project implementation process and in production and business activities. For example, currently, some mining sites are not operating at their designed capacity or there are mines that have not been put into operation as scheduled due to difficulties in site clearance, compensation, land lease, relocation of resettlement areas, conversion of forest use purpose for disposal sites, interrupted resource of material for production, unstable ore quality, and high prices of ores.

Leaders of departments, sectors and localities discussed and answered issues that businesses reported on administrative procedures (investment, construction, environment, minerals); site clearance; input of raw materials for production, and output of products.

Standing Vice Chairman of the Lao Cai Provincial People’s Committee Hoang Quoc Khanh affirmed that enterprises operating in the industrial sector are the pillar in the local economic development. Therefore, relevant sectors and localities will soon propose solutions to remove difficulties for businesses to ensure a smooth supply of raw materials for their operations. Local authorities also need to pay attention to site clearance compensation in the fastest and most appropriate manner. The provincial Department of Natural Resources and Environment and investors will coordinate closely with local authorities to provide a specific and appropriate roadmap for the task.

Regarding investment, the provincial Department of Planning and Investment is the agency that receives and provides specific guidance to businesses on granting investment certificates in a set period of time. Regarding the provincial Department of Industry and Trade, those units which are in charge of mineral resource exploitation will continue to review contents of mineral mining, review each project, and seek ways to solve difficulties and problems for businesses.
